Movie
Date
Based On
 
Midnight Madness
 
February 8, 1980  
The Watcher in the Woods (horror film)
 
April 17, 1980
Novel by Florence Engel Randall
Herbie Goes Bananas
 
June 25, 1980
 
The Last Flight of Noah’s Ark
June 25, 1980
Based on The Gremlin’s Castle (story) by Ernest K. Gann
Popeye
 
Dec. 12, 1980
Based on the Popeye comic strip
The Devil and Max Devlin
 
March 6, 1981
 
Amy
 
March 20, 1981
 
Dragonslayer
 
June 26, 1981
 
The Fox and the Hound
July 10, 1981
Based on the novel by Daniel P. Mannix 
Condorman
August 7, 1981
Based on The Game of X by Robert Sheckley
Night Crossing
February 5, 1982
Based on the true stories Strelzyk and Wetzel families
Tron
 
July 9, 1982
 
Tex
 
July 30, 1982
Based on the Novel by S.E. Hinton
Trenchcoat
 
March 11, 1983
 
Something Wicked This Way Comes
 
April 29, 1983
Based on the Novel by Ray Bradbury
Never Cry Wolf
October 7, 1983
Based on Fawley Mowat’s Autobiography by the same name
Return to Oz
June 21, 1985
Loosely based on the novels by Frank Baum
The Black Cauldron
July 24, 1985
Based on the first two books in The Chronicles of Prydain by Lloyd Alexander
The Journey of Natty Gann
 
Sept. 27, 1985
 
One Magic Christmas 
 
Nov. 22, 1985
 
The Great Mouse Detective
July 2, 1986
Based on the children’s book series, Basil of Baker Street by Eve Titus
Flight of the Navigator
 
July 2, 1986
 
Benji the Hunted
 
June 17, 1987  
The Man from Snowy River II:Return to Snowy River
April 15, 1988
Based on the Banjo Paterson poem by the same name
Oliver & Company
November 18, 1988
Inspired by Oliver Twist by Charles Dickens
Honey, I Shrunk the Kids
 
June 23, 1989
 
Cheetah
 
August 18, 1989 
(features the phrase Hakuna Matata)
The Little Mermaid
November 17, 1989
Based on the Danish fairy tale by Hans Christian Anderson
